在现代的软件开发与数据管理中,跨数据库复制和跨页面复制组件是两个常见的需求,本文将深入探讨这两种操作的概念、实现方法及其在实际场景中的应用。
跨数据库复制详解
1. 基本概念与应用场景
定义:跨数据库复制涉及将数据从一个数据库准确复制到另一个数据库的过程,这种操作通常用于数据迁移、备份或是在分布式系统中保持数据的一致性。
应用场景:在企业级应用中,跨数据库复制常用于负载均衡、数据同步及灾难恢复等策略,电商平台可能会复制用户数据到备份数据库以应对系统故障。
2. 复制方法
使用SQL语句:如MySQL数据库中,可以使用INSERT INTO
和SELECT
语句结合来复制数据,当目标表已存在时,使用insert into 目的数据库..表 select * from 源数据库..表
;若目标表不存在,则可以使用select * into 目的数据库..表 from 源数据库..表
。
工具辅助:除直接使用SQL语句外,还可以利用各种数据库管理工具如PHPMyAdmin等,通过图形界面简化操作过程。
3. 注意事项
数据一致性:确保在复制过程中数据能够保持一致性,避免因复制导致的信息遗漏或错误。
权限设置:操作前需确认是否有足够的权限对数据库进行读写操作。
4. 实际案例分析
案例一:一家金融公司需要将其客户数据从一个MySQL数据库迁移到另一个作为备份,通过使用INSERT INTO ... SELECT
语句,他们成功地将客户信息无差错地传输到了备份数据库。
案例二:开发团队在进行新功能测试时,需要将部分生产数据复制到测试数据库,他们使用了图形界面工具实现了数据的精确复制,确保测试环境的有效性。
跨页面复制组件详解
1. 基本概念与应用场景
定义:跨页面复制组件是指在网页或应用的不同页面之间复制相同的功能组件,以减少重复工作并保持界面一致性。
应用场景:在开发单页应用(SPA)或多页面应用时,复用组件可以大幅提升开发效率和用户体验。
2. 复制方法
使用快捷键:大多数现代前端框架和设计工具支持使用快捷键(如Ctrl+C和Ctrl+V)来复制和粘贴组件。
特定工具功能:许多设计软件如即时设计工具集提供了“快速复制”等特色功能,允许用户快速在页面间复制组件。
3. 注意事项
样式一致性:在跨页面复制组件时,确保所有页面中的组件样式保持一致,避免给用户带来困扰。
性能考虑:避免在单页应用中复制大量大型组件,以免影响页面加载速度和应用性能。
4. 实际案例分析
案例一:一个开发团队在构建一个多页面的教育平台时,通过复制已设计好的课程列表组件到每个科目的页面,大幅减少了设计时间。
案例二:设计师在制作一个电子商务网站的多个产品页面时,通过快速复制工具批量生成了产品展示区,使得整个网站的风格和布局保持一致。
互联网上关于跨数据库复制和跨页面复制组件的最新内容显示,随着技术的发展,这些操作变得更加简便快捷,无论是通过直接的SQL操作、利用数据库管理工具,还是通过现代前端框架和设计工具的辅助,开发者和设计师都能找到适合自己需求的解决方案,这也提示我们在进行相关操作时,应注意数据一致性、权限设置及性能问题。
无论是在数据库管理还是在前端开发中,跨数据库复制和跨页面复制组件都是提高开发效率和保障数据安全的重要手段,通过掌握正确的方法和使用合适的工具,可以有效地实现数据和组件的快速、安全复制,希望本文提供的信息能为面对类似需求的开发者和设计师提供帮助。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/797747.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复